Axcelis(ACLS) - 2025 Q3 - Earnings Call Transcript
2025-11-04 14:30
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- The company reported third-quarter revenue of $214 million and non-GAAP earnings per diluted share of $1.21, both exceeding expectations [6][21] - GAAP gross margin was 41.6%, while non-GAAP gross margin was 41.8%, below the expected 43% due to product mix [23][24] - GAAP operating margin was 11.7%, and non-GAAP operating margin was 18.2% [25] - The company generated approximately $43 million in free cash flow during the third quarter [27]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- Systems revenue was $144 million, while CS and I revenue reached a record $70 million, driven by strong demand for spares and consumables [21][22] - Bookings in the third quarter declined to $52 million, with a backlog of $484 million at the end of the quarter [22][28] - Revenue from the power business grew sequentially, particularly in silicon carbide applications, while general mature revenue declined [11][16]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- Sales to China decreased sequentially to 46% of total sales, down from 55% in the prior quarter [22] - The company anticipates a decline in revenue from China in the fourth quarter, consistent with previous expectations [22][45] - Sales to the U.S. accounted for 14% of total sales, while Korea accounted for 10% [22]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company announced a merger with Veeco, aiming to create a leading semiconductor equipment company and capitalize on trends in AI and electrification [7][10] - The merger is expected to enhance cross-sell synergies and optimize technology advancements [8][9] - The company is focused on maintaining a strong aftermarket strategy and growing its installed base to support profitability and cash flow [20]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management expressed optimism about bookings improving sequentially in the fourth quarter, driven by encouraging quoting activity [6][10] - The company is navigating a cyclical digestion period across markets while remaining disciplined on cost control [19] - Management noted that while 2025 has been a year of digestion, they see potential growth opportunities in 2026, particularly in memory and power markets [45][50] Other Important Information - The company implemented a one-time voluntary retirement program, with additional expenses expected in the fourth quarter [24] - The company exited the third quarter with a strong balance sheet, including $593 million in cash and marketable securities [27] Q&A Session Summary Question: Dynamics in the other power category - Management noted that Chinese customers are adding capacity in silicon carbide, while non-Chinese customers are not transitioning significantly [35] Question: Tariff impacts on the business - The company is managing through the tariff environment and expects potential impacts in 2026 as tariff costs move into the P&L [38] Question: China demand outlook for 2026 - Management indicated that China demand will depend on end demand environments and progress on chip self-sufficiency targets [45] Question: Memory market outlook - Management highlighted that demand is currently coming from DRAM and HBM, with expectations for new greenfield capacity to be brought online [50] Question: CS and I revenue sustainability - Management confirmed that the current level of CS and I revenue is expected to be sustainable, driven by improved utilization rates [66] Question: Bookings expectations for Q4 - Management anticipates bookings to increase across all customer segments, with a build-up of pressure leading to purchase orders [70] Question: Adoption of silicon carbide outside of electric vehicles - Management mentioned potential applications in the electric grid and data centers, indicating a growing market for silicon carbide [116]
AerCap Holdings N.V. (AER) Delivers Record Q3 Earnings and Boosts 2025 Outlook
Yahoo Finance· 2025-11-03 10:32
Core Insights - AerCap Holdings N.V. reported strong Q3 2025 results with net income of $1.216 billion and adjusted earnings of $865 million, raising its full-year adjusted EPS guidance to $13.70 [1][2] - The company recovered $475 million related to assets lost in the Ukraine conflict, totaling $2.9 billion in recoveries since 2023 [2] - AerCap achieved a 27% return on equity and increased its book value per share by 20% year-over-year [2] Financial Performance - The company posted $1.216 billion in net income and $865 million in adjusted earnings for Q3 2025 [1] - Full-year adjusted EPS guidance was raised to $13.70, driven by strong asset sales totaling $1.5 billion and a record $332 million gain-on-sale [1] - AerCap's adjusted debt-to-equity ratio stood at 2.1 to 1 at quarter-end [2] Operational Highlights - Major aircraft deal with Airbus and certification and delivery of Boeing 777-300ERSF freighters were key operational achievements [2] - The company generated $1.5 billion in operating cash flow [2] Strategic Partnerships - AerCap signed a seven-year agreement with GE Aerospace for lease pool management services for the GE9X engine, enhancing its service capabilities [3][4] - This agreement strengthens the partnership with GE Aerospace and extends the engine leasing relationship into the next decade [4] Company Overview - AerCap Holdings N.V. is the world's largest aviation leasing company, providing long-term leases for commercial aircraft, engines, and helicopters [5] - The company offers comprehensive fleet solutions, including new and used assets, and provides aviation-related services such as engine and aircraft trading [5]

The Unexpected Bull Case for AMD Stock
The Motley Fool· 2025-10-30 09:30
Core Viewpoint - Advanced Micro Devices (AMD) is positioned as a significant player in the AI chip market, potentially benefiting from historical investment advice from Jack Welch, emphasizing the importance of being a top competitor in the industry [2][4][14] Investment Case for AMD - AMD has established critical partnerships with companies like OpenAI and Oracle, reinforcing its role in the AI sector [1] - The company is currently viewed as the No. 2 AI chip manufacturer, following Nvidia, which has a dominant market position [5][6] - AMD's upcoming MI400X GPU, expected in the second half of 2026, may enhance its competitive stance against Nvidia [7] Market Capitalization and Growth Potential - AMD's market capitalization stands at approximately $430 billion, significantly smaller than Nvidia's $5 trillion, suggesting greater potential for stock price appreciation [8][9] - Doubling AMD's market cap to $860 billion is more feasible compared to Nvidia needing to reach $10 trillion for the same growth [9] Financial Metrics - AMD's current stock price is $264.18, with a P/E ratio of 152, which is higher than Nvidia's P/E ratio of 58 [10][13] - The data center segment, which includes AI accelerators, accounted for 46% of AMD's revenue in the first half of 2025, indicating substantial exposure to AI [11] Competitive Landscape - Nvidia's data center segment represented 88% of its total revenue in the first half of fiscal 2026, highlighting a more concentrated focus on AI compared to AMD [12] - Despite AMD's higher valuation metrics, its smaller size and improving technology may lead to better long-term returns for investors [15]
